What is sibling rivalry in blended families?

Sibling rivalry in blended families refers to the competition, jealousy, and conflicts that arise between stepsiblings and half-siblings. These dynamics can be more complex due to the different family backgrounds, loyalties, and adjustments to new family structures.

Why is sibling rivalry more pronounced in blended families?

Sibling rivalry can be more pronounced in blended families due to several factors. Children may struggle with feelings of displacement, fear of losing parental attention, and the challenge of forming new relationships with stepsiblings. Additionally, differing parenting styles and household rules can exacerbate tensions.

How can parents manage sibling rivalry in blended families?

Parents can manage sibling rivalry by fostering open communication, setting clear and consistent rules, and encouraging bonding activities. It is essential to give each child individual attention and validate their feelings. Family counseling can also be beneficial to navigate complex emotions and build a harmonious environment.

What role does communication play in reducing sibling rivalry?

Communication is crucial in reducing sibling rivalry. It helps children express their feelings, understand each other’s perspectives, and resolve conflicts constructively. Parents should model effective communication skills and provide a safe space for children to talk about their concerns and experiences.

Are there any long-term effects of unresolved sibling rivalry in blended families?

Unresolved sibling rivalry in blended families can lead to long-term effects such as persistent family tension, strained sibling relationships, and emotional distress. It can also impact children’s self-esteem and social skills. Addressing rivalry early can prevent these negative outcomes and promote a supportive family environment.

How can blended families create a sense of unity despite sibling rivalry?

Blended families can create a sense of unity by establishing family traditions, promoting teamwork through joint activities, and celebrating each member’s uniqueness. Building trust and respect among all family members is key. Parents should lead by example, showing cooperation and mutual support.
